§ 18-8-9 — Report and disposition of fines collected

West Virginia·Ch. 18 EDUCATION·Art. 8 COMPULSORY SCHOOL ATTENDANCE
All fines collected under the provisions of this article shall be paid on or before the last day of each calendar month by the magistrate, or other proper official having jurisdiction in the case, to the sheriff and by him credited to the county school fund; and the magistrate shall file with the county superintendent on the last day of each month an itemized statement of all fines paid over to the sheriff.
